Combining a long life span in harsh environments with smooth actuation, the MCS18 ES and MCS22 ES stainless-steel switches are resistant to impact as per IK07, according to EN 60529. Momentary actuation requires a minimal force of 2.8N and a medium travel of 1.7 mm. Both the switch actuator and housing have a built-in mechanical end-stop to protect the contact element under stress. The switches are available in mounting sizes of 18 mm and 22 mm and connect via screw terminals. Price is $12.70 each/100 with delivery from stock to eight weeks. SCHURTER INC., Santa Rosa, CA.
